有时候需要把文本文件根据一定的格式批量导入数据库,MSSQLSERVER提供了这样的导入语句:

  BULK INSERT EBSS..MSS_ActingWork_ML FROM 'C:\表数据\MSS_ActingWork_ML.txt'
  WITH
  (
     FIELDTERMINATOR = ',',
     ROWTERMINATOR = '\n'
  )

 

EBSS是数据库名

MSS_ActingWork_ML是数据库表名

C:\表数据\MSS_ActingWork_ML.txt是文本文件的地址

FIELDTERMINATOR = ','是一行里字段的分割

ROWTERMINATOR = '\n'是行的分割

 

但是这句SQL语句有一个很大的问题,就是当文本文件里一行导入出现问题,就会部导入不成功,纠结!!

相关文章:

  • 2021-07-18
  • 2022-12-23
  • 2021-11-30
  • 2022-01-01
  • 2022-01-22
  • 2021-12-30
  • 2022-12-23
猜你喜欢
  • 2021-12-03
  • 2022-12-23
  • 2022-12-23
  • 2022-02-19
  • 2021-11-20
  • 2022-12-23
相关资源
相似解决方案